## Pennon Relay: WebSocket Compression

Per-message deflate saves ~60% bandwidth on the Tideworth feed but opens a compression-oracle surface on attacker-influenced frames. We disable context takeover for any channel carrying user input and compress only server-generated telemetry. CPU cost is bounded by window size. The reviewer should verify the enforced parameters, listed below.

tuning table, yajog-yahof:
BUDGETS = {
    "lamvan": 303,
    "wenox": 460,
    "fenvan": 525,
}

Leadership Review Briefing — Support Outsourcing

Vellmar Goods proposes moving Tier 1 support to Quindell Services' Harlow Bay centre by Q3. Projected savings: 22% annually. Tier 2 remains in-house under Mira Castell. Risks: handover gaps, early churn in the Pellan product line. Pilot runs eight weeks. Department heads must confirm staffing impacts by Friday. The confidential expansion detail follows below.

internal memo for hahif-hahaf: Headcount on the Zorwyn team goes from 9 to 100 by the end of October. Gross margin on Zorwyn came in at 5 percent against a plan of 10 percent.

Ticket: Config drift in FeedProof validator fleet

For the weekly sync: the three FeedProof instances behind the Mirabel gateway have drifted. Instance B was hand-edited during the enclosure-size incident last month and never reconciled, so it now rejects feeds the other two accept, producing inconsistent validation results for the same podcast. We need to agree on a canonical baseline and re-apply it everywhere via the deploy pipeline. The intended canonical configuration is as follows.

deployment values, fadug-bawif:
SORWYN_LOG_LEVEL=debug
SORWYN_METRICS_HOST=metrics.sorwyn.qirvansys.internal
SORWYN_POOL_SIZE=32